I'm looking forward to it. We won't be getting touchbacks 90% of the time. And touchbacks weren't even safe anyway. By the time the returner took a knee guys were already colliding at full speed.

I also think it has potential to make kickoffs even more fun than before touchbacks became so common. It's practically the first play from scrimmage now, and I think it will leave more room for designed plays on kickoffs. And since it's safer teams might be more willing to use starters on special teams. I hate seeing dynamic returners like Tyreek Hill lose their job since they are too valuable on offense.
